Paul C. Easton
I am Managing Director for Global Colleague's Asian operations. Global Colleague is a legal services outsourcing firm based in Washington D.C. and operations in India and Taiwan.
I have managed high-volume document productions in massive litigations and regulatory investigations for numerous multinationals and the law firms that represent them.
My passion is professionalizing document review and evangelizing the value of applying project management standards to the increasingly complex and massive litigations faced by lawyers today.
I also have a passion for deep-fried and highly questionable Taiwanese night market food, but find that not many clients, co-workers, or friends share that passion. I humor them with talk about the weather instead.

My Company
Global Colleague is a legal services firms focused on providing litigation support, document review, and contract services.Our teams act as a single, integrated extension of your firm, regardless of the locations and languages they work in. We currently have offices and staff in the United States, India, and Taiwan. We also have the ability to stage, staff, and manage projects in Brazil, Korea, and Nigeria in English, Chinese, Korean, Japanese, Portuguese, and Spanish. We are adept at managing complex, multilingual document reviews under tight deadlines.
